Appeal and finality

Act: Balochistan Waqf Properties Act 2020

Section Provisions

ACT III OF 2020 ACT III OF 2020 BALOCHISTAN WAQF PROPERTIES ACT, 2020 An Act to make provisions and to repeal be existing Waqf Properties Ordinance, 1979 [Gazette of Balochistan Extraordinary, 1st September, 2020] No. PAB/Legis;V(02)/2020, dated 1.9.2020.---The Balochistan Waqf Properties Bill, 2020 (Bill No. 02 of 2020),having been passed by the Provincial Assembly of Balochistan on 26th August, 2020 and assented to by the Governor, Balochistan on 31st August, 2020 is hereby published as an Act of the Balochistan Provincial Assembly. WHEREAS to cater for the monitoring an evaluation purposes of the Waqf and to make provisions relating to the proper management and administration of Waqf Properties in Balochistan Province. AND WHEREAS it is expedient to make provisions relating to proper management and administration of waqf properties in the Balochistan or matters incidental thereto; 13. Appeal and finality.---(1) Any person evicted under the provisions of section 11 or aggrieved by an order of termination of lease or resumption of tenancy made under section 12 may, within sixty days of such eviction or within thirty days of the order of termination of the lease or resumption of tenancy, prefer an appeal to the Chief Administrator and the Chief Administrator may, after giving such person an opportunity of being heard, confirm, modify or vacate the order made by the Administrator under section 11 or 12. (2) If there is no appeal against an eviction under section 11 or an order or of termination of lease or resumption of tenancy made by the Administrator under section 12 of the eviction, termination of lease or resumption of tenancy, as the case may be, shall be final, and when there is an appeal, the decision of the Chief Administrator in appeal shall be final.
